Jon Prosser today shared some information about a foldable iPhone being developed internally by Apple. He said that the foldable iPhone is real, and the appearance of the device will be similar to the Samsung Galaxy Z Flip. .
In addition, Prosser also revealed that the internal screen of the foldable iPhone will actually be two independent panels , similar to Microsoft’s Surface Duo, instead of using flexible glass. However, Prosser said that when the foldable iPhone is opened, they look closer to seamless and without bangs. The hinges are protected by fabric, and the edges will be made of metal like the iPhone 11. Fabric hinges can prevent debris from entering and will be more durable than current foldable phones.
Prosser said that the foldable iPhone has a secondary external display and a small “forehead” where the Face ID component is located.
Prosser also said that several sources have confirmed the existence of this device, but it is not yet certain when Apple will finally release this device.
Naijatechnews needs to point out that no matter how detailed Prosser describes, it is currently unable to verify the authenticity of this information.
